Film Review: Premium Rush


Powered by Guardian.co.ukThis article titled “Premium Rush – review” was written by Henry Barnes, for The Guardian on Thursday 13th September 2012 21.07 UTC

The gears are fixed and there’s no brakes and Joseph Gordon-Levitt couldn’t stop, even if he wanted to in this breathless chase movie, set in the punky, preachy sub-culture of New York’s bike messenger scene. Gordon-Levitt plays Wilee (as in the coyote), a daredevil rider swishing through red lights and hopping the pavement to make his next drop-off in time. Michael Shannon, hammy as a butcher’s shop, is the dirty cop using a nasty old car to intercept the message. Wilee has an on-off girlfriend (Dania Ramirez) and a rival on the road (Wolé Parks), but the film spins past them pretty swiftly. This is about the bike, the road and the compulsion to go, go, go. Cycling proficiency teachers will hate it.
